
DevOps Team Lead
Chester or London, England, United Kingdom£100,000 - £110,000 per yearEngineering
Job description
About us
Equals Money’s mission is to make money movement simple. We develop and sell scalable payment platforms to enable organisations and individuals to move and easily manage their money flows through payment and card products.

Job requirements
Responsibilities
Take control of our existing AWS real estate
Ensure we’re following AWS best practice throughout
Deliver infrastructure from start to finish & work with engineers to ensure the first deployment success
Collaborate with product managers, engineers, and other stakeholders to plan and prioritise workstreams
Help setup monitoring and alerting for all our infrastructure.
Promote best practices within the team, focusing on quality, collaboration, mentorship, and continuous improvement
Drive the architecture and design of solutions, ensuring scalability, security, performance and resilience
Desired skills
You may not have all of these, but that’s ok.
Significant experience with Terraform
Experience with core AWS services (VPC, EC2, RDS, CloudFront, ECS/Fargate, Lambda etc)
Experience with multiple account setups (AWS Organisations, SSO)
Deep knowledge of application, server and network security
Containerisation platforms (Docker)
CI tools, e.g. GitHub Actions, CircleCI, CodeBuild
Software engineering practices like BDD, TDD, Pair Programming etc.
